Does the perfect museum specimen exist? What’s the squishiest? The most exuberant? Or even the most noxious? We’re taking a look through 80 million specimens to find the ‘perfect’ examples for you. Join us each episode as Josh and Natalie try to surprise each other with their choices from the collections, their only prompt? A single word.
